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t vs Cooked Frozen Carrots:
- 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t has 2.4 times more Vitamin B2, 2.1 times more Vitamin B9, 1.8 times more Vitamin C and 2.8 times more Vitamin K than Cooked Frozen Carrots.
- While 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ains 36.8 times more Vitamin A, 3.6 times more Vitamin B5, 1.4 times more Vitamin B6 and 25.3 times more Vitamin E than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t.
- Both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t and Cooked Frozen Carrots provide similar amounts of Vitamin B1 and Vitamin B3 per one pound.
- 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B5 and Vitamin E
- Both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t vs Cooked Frozen Carrots:
- 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t has 1.2 times more Iron, 1.7 times more Magnesium, 1.7 times more Manganese and 4.2 times more Sodium than Cooked Frozen Carrots.
- While 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ains 1.4 times more Copper and 1.5 times more Zinc than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t.
- Both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t and Cooked Frozen Carrots contain similar levels of Calcium, Phosphorus, Potassium and Water per one pound.
- Both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ots lack sufficient amounts of Selenium in one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t has 2.6 times more Protein than Cooked Frozen Carrots.
- While 1 lb of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ots contains 2.2 times more Sugars than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t.
- Both Cooked Frozen Green Snap Beans with Salt and Cooked Frozen Carrots offer comparable quantities of Omega 3, Carbohydrate and Fiber per one pound.
- 1 pound of Cooked Frozen Carrots provide inadequate amounts of Protein
- Both Boiled Frozen Green Snap Beans, drained with Salt as well as Boiled and Drained Frozen Carrots provide inadequate amounts of Energy and Omega 6 in one pound.
